texte = BTW - thanks guys for this!! Brilliant! Gave me an idea for doing more neat tricks based on this... -JohnMichael Winston wrote:> > >we recently found a solution to this problem which went something like: > >> > >>[LISTWORDS delimiters=[URL] > > >[/URL]&words=[INCLUDE file]] > > > > Also, the full syntax (which I only point out because I don't want > people to copy and paste the above and wonder why they're not getting > any output)is: > > [LISTWORDS delimiters=[URL] > [/URL]&words=[URL][INCLUDE file][/URL]][WORD][/LISTWORDS] > ############################################################# This message is sent to you because you are subscribed to the mailing list .
